  • How to download the address book from Iphone to the computer

    i want to create an address backup in the macbook, but don't how to save the address book from Iphone 4 to the computer.

    Syncing of the contacts from the iPhone to the Mac address book is accomplished through iTunes. Once the iPhone is connected, you go to the Info tab in iTunes and select to sync the contacts to the particular application, in your case, Address book. Make sure you have at least one contact in address book you don't have on the iPhone to ensure it gives you the option to merge the two. That is the only way to get the contact onto the computer. Then you can backup the computer.

  • How can I download my address book from other e-mail accounts of mine?

    I left yahoo as my default e-mail because the contact address book no longer functions. I can only get my list as I compose a message and begin typing the name. I have other e-mail accounts such as Comcast and g-mail. How can I import them into my new default Thunderbird address book?

    Export the address books from your providers as a comma separated file. Type .CSV file.
    Then open the address book window in Thunderbird and use Tools-Import to bring them into Thunderbird.
